* Repo: handle worktrees betterPeter Jones2017-07-011-3/+24
| | | | | | | | | | | | | This makes Repo("foo") work when foo/.git is a file of the form created by "git worktree add", i.e. it's a text file that says: gitdir: /home/me/project/.git/worktrees/bar and where /home/me/project/.git/ is the nominal gitdir, but /home/me/project/.git/worktrees/bar has this worktree's HEAD etc and a "gitdir" file that contains the path of foo/.git .
